The confusion as I see it is that there is two / slash marks in the call and
the program gets confused as to which is the portable call.
You see when you go portable to a location outside your calling area you are
already a portable operation.
EXAMPLE: If you go to the 8th call area you would sign WA4OYH/8 , on a
phone contact you would say WA4OYH portable 8.
 So SV5/DJ5AA/P should sign his call DJ5AA portable SV5
and the log entry should say DJ5AA/SV5 or SV5/DJ5AA
 You can operate portable and just be a portable operation
and sign WA4OYH/p and you can make that entry into your log with no
problems.
 This practice has been around for the 40 years I have been interested in
Amateur radio I hope this answers your confusion.

The /P could be very important if the DX station keeps separate logs for
each call he uses. It would not be good to have a card returned "not in log"
because of a missing /P. It is a never ending task for DXBase to keep up
with all the changes in call signs over the world, but portable operations
have been with us for a long time and handling them should be addressed by
the developers of DXBase.
